rtthread空闲中断
时间: 2023-09-04 22:08:33 浏览: 52
RT-Thread是一个开源的实时操作系统,可以适用于多种嵌入式平台。在STM32上使用RT-Thread时,使用串口的DMA空闲中断可以实现接收不定长数据。
具体的开发环境和工程配置可以参考博文https://blog.csdn.net/coderdd/article/details/108264369 ,该博文提供了详细的步骤和代码示例。
在RT-Thread Studio v2.1.0开发环境中,使用STM32F407VG芯片,可以按照以下步骤进行配置:
1. 打开RT-Thread Studio v2.1.0,创建一个新的工程。
2. 在工程配置中选择STM32F407VG芯片作为目标芯片。
3. 添加相应的代码,并进行测试。
4. 可以通过配置串口的DMA空闲中断来实现接收不定长数据。
通过以上步骤,可以在RT-Thread中实现rtthread空闲中断的功能。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[rt-thread+stm32 使用串口dma空闲中断接收不定长数据](https://blog.csdn.net/gyzw_mx/article/details/115899755)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]